Rosalind Willison-Hannah, age 72 of Spring Lake died Wednesday, August 30, 2023, at Mercy Health St.Mary's Campus. She was born August 16, 1951, the daughter of Herman and Rose (Carskegdon) Bates. Rosalind graduated from Davenport College with a bachelor's Degree and worked in sales until 2006 when she opened Spring Lake Bridal where she performed many roles including seamstress. When Rosalind was younger, She also made an annual event of spending two weeks every year at the beach on Lake Michigan with her family, her sisters, and their families. She enjoyed oil painting and Bingo. She also was an avid traveler. Rosalind was always ready for an adventure and her travels took her around the world. No matter where she went Rosalind made lasting friends around the globe. She made it a point to share her travels with as many friends and family as she could. She married Maurice "Morrie" Hannah, Jr. in 1989 Rosalind and Morrie enjoyed spending their evenings watching the sunset with coffee or ice cream. Above all, she was very devoted to her entire family and a loving mother.
